1.4亿在线背后-QQ IM后台架构的演化与启示
http://djt.qq.com/article/view/19
优酷上还有讲座视频
腾讯微信技术总监周颢:一亿用户增长背后的架构秘密
http://vdisk.weibo.com/s/r2C_WkgrEBi
- 浏览: 1088693 次
- 性别:
- 来自: 北京
最新评论
-
kafodaote:
Kafka分布式消息系统实战(与JavaScalaHadoop ...
分布式消息系统Kafka初步 -
小灯笼:
LoadRunner性能测试实战课程网盘地址:http://p ...
LoadRunner性能测试应用(八) -
成大大的:
Kafka分布式消息系统实 ...
分布式消息系统Kafka初步 -
hulalayaha2:
Loadrunner性能测试视频教程下载学习:http://p ...
LoadRunner性能测试应用(八) -
993042835:
搞好 谢谢
org.hibernate.exception.ConstraintViolationException: could not delete:
相关推荐
### 百万用户级游戏服务器架构设计 #### 一、引言 随着互联网技术的不断发展,网络游戏已经成为人们娱乐生活中不可或缺的一部分。为了满足数以百万计的用户同时在线的需求,游戏服务器的设计面临着前所未有的挑战...
"SAAS 架构设计模式" SAAS 架构设计模式是软件即服务(Software as a Service)的架构设计模式。它的出现是为了解决软件开发和维护的成本问题,通过将软件部署到云端,提供基于互联网的软件服务,用户可以通过...
### 架构设计方法教材知识点解析 #### 一、软件架构的基本理解 - **定义**:软件架构是指软件系统的主要结构及其组成部分之间的关系。它不仅仅关注于代码的编写,更侧重于系统的整体规划与设计。 - **作用**:良好...
618是中国电商行业的一个重要促销节点,京东在这个期间积累了大量的技术经验和架构设计的实践。文档中提到的618经验包括架构的弹性扩展、应对高并发场景的策略、数据库的优化、系统的容灾备份等方面,强调了在大型...
微博Cache架构设计实践涉及了缓存系统的设计原理、实施策略、以及在实际运营中遇到的问题和解决方案。 缓存(Cache)是一种用于临时存储频繁访问数据的技术,它能够显著减少数据的读取时间,降低后端服务器的压力,...
技术架构设计原则是在构建软件系统时所要遵循的一系列理念和规则,其目的是为了确保系统能够顺利地扩展和维护,同时满足性能、安全、稳定性等方面的要求。在设计技术架构时,有几大核心原则需要特别关注:大道至简、...
【系统架构设计师】是IT行业中一个关键的角色,其主要职责在于理解和管理非功能性系统需求,制定开发规范,设计系统的整体架构,以及明确关键技术细节。系统架构师不仅关注技术实现,还需协调团队工作,确保功能需求...
为了获得最佳的用户体验,前端架构设计需要优化资源的加载速度,比如通过最小化增量加载的资源量、合并多个资源以提高加载速度以及利用浏览器缓存来提高响应效率。 为了实现这些优化目标,模块化的前端资源管理系统...
分布式架构的核心思想是采用大量廉价的PC Server,构建一个低成本、高可用、高可扩展、高吞吐的集群系统,以支撑海量的用户访问和数据存储,理论上具备无限的扩展能力。分布式系统的设计,是一门复杂的学问,它涉及...
大并发架构设计旨在确保系统在面对大量用户同时访问时仍能保持高性能、高可用性和高可靠性。以下详细解析了大并发架构设计中涉及的关键知识点。 1. 高质量软件架构设计 高质量软件架构设计是系统设计的基石,它要求...
例如,一个电子商务平台可能需要处理大量的并发交易,这就要求架构设计能够支持高并发和快速响应。 接下来是选择合适的架构风格。常见的架构风格有单体架构、微服务架构、分布式系统架构、事件驱动架构等。单体架构...
4. **改善用户体验**:高质量的架构设计能够提高系统的响应速度和可用性,从而提升用户的整体体验。 #### 四、高可靠的架构设计 - **定义**:高可靠的架构设计指的是能够确保系统在各种情况下都能够正常运行的设计...
1. **高并发处理**:保险业务往往涉及大量用户并发操作,如查询、购买和理赔等。通过微服务化,可以将这些业务分解为独立的服务,如用户管理、产品展示、订单处理等,确保在高并发场景下的稳定性和响应速度。 2. **...
8. **数据分析与报表**:SaaS系统通常会收集大量用户数据,这些数据可用于改进服务、预测需求或生成业务洞察。因此,内置的数据分析和报表工具是必不可少的。 9. **版本管理和更新**:SaaS模型允许频繁地发布新版本...
在IT行业中,架构设计是构建复杂系统的关键步骤,它涉及到如何组织和协调系统各个部分,以实现高效、可扩展和可维护的解决方案。"架构设计思路样例.zip"中的资源,包括"多端行为日志采集方案.docx"和"数聚蜂巢白皮书...
《系统架构设计师教程》不仅提供了理论知识,还包含了大量的实践案例,帮助读者将所学应用到实际项目中。无论是初入行业的新人还是经验丰富的专业人士,都能从中受益,提升自己的需求分析能力和系统架构设计水平。...
SaaS架构设计所涉及的知识点主要包括云计算、网络编程、数据库管理、微服务架构、DevOps、安全性等关键领域。 1. 云计算基础:SaaS的实现依赖于云计算平台,它们提供了必要的计算资源、存储和网络连接。云服务模型...